Types of Lighting Fixtures:
When it comes to outdoor lighting for beach house sun decks, there are several types of fixtures to consider. These include:
-
Deck Lights: Deck lights are typically installed on the surface of the deck or along its perimeter to provide subtle illumination. They can be recessed into the deck boards or mounted on posts or railings. LED deck lights are a popular choice due to their energy efficiency and durability.
-
Pathway Lights: Pathway lights guide guests along walkways and stairs leading to the sun deck while adding an enchanting glow to the landscape. Solar-powered pathway lights are a great option as they require minimal maintenance and rely on renewable energy sources.
-
Accent Lights: Accent lights are used to highlight specific features or areas on the sun deck, such as architectural elements, artwork, or plantings. These can be spotlights, uplights, or downlights strategically placed for dramatic effect.
-
String Lights: String lights add a magical ambiance to any outdoor space and are particularly popular for creating a cozy atmosphere on beach house sun decks. They can be strung across beams, railings, or overhead structures.
Effective Illumination Techniques:
To achieve effective illumination while minimizing light pollution concerns, here are some techniques to consider:
-
Use shielded fixtures: Shielded fixtures direct light downward and prevent unnecessary glare and light spillage into neighboring properties or natural habitats.
-
Opt for warm-colored bulbs: Warm-colored bulbs with lower color temperatures create a more inviting atmosphere compared to cool white tones commonly used in commercial settings.
-
Layer lighting: Combining different types of fixtures at varying heights creates depth and visual interest while ensuring even distribution of light across the sun deck.
Energy Efficiency Considerations:
Selecting energy-efficient options not only reduces electricity costs but also minimizes environmental impact. Here are some considerations:
-
LED Lights: LED lights are highly energy-efficient and have a longer lifespan compared to traditional incandescent or halogen bulbs. They also produce less heat, making them safer for outdoor use.
-
Motion Sensors and Timers: Installing motion sensors or timers can ensure that lights are only activated when needed, further reducing energy consumption.
-
Solar-Powered Lights: Consider incorporating solar-powered lights into your outdoor lighting design, especially for pathway or accent lighting. These lights harness the sun’s energy during the day and automatically illuminate at night without requiring any electrical connection.

When it comes to selecting outdoor lighting fixtures for your beach house sun deck, there are several factors to consider. First and foremost is the purpose of the lighting – what do you want to achieve with it? Is it purely functional, providing illumination for safety purposes? Or perhaps you desire an ambiance that highlights specific features or creates a certain mood?
To guide you in making an informed decision, here are some key considerations when choosing outdoor lighting fixtures:
-
Style: The style of the fixture should complement the overall design aesthetic of your beach house. Whether you prefer modern, traditional, or coastal-inspired designs, there is a wide range of options available to suit your taste.
-
Durability: Since these fixtures will be exposed to various weather conditions such as saltwater spray and intense sunlight, they need to be made from durable materials like stainless steel or corrosion-resistant finishes.
-
Energy Efficiency: Opting for LED (light-emitting diode) fixtures can significantly reduce energy consumption while still providing ample light output. This not only helps lower electricity bills but also contributes positively to the environment.
-
Ease of Installation and Maintenance: Consider fixtures that are easy to install and maintain so that you can enjoy hassle-free operation throughout their lifespan.

To avoid encountering similar issues and maintain optimal functionality of your outdoor lighting setup, here are some crucial maintenance tips:
-
Regular Cleaning:
- Remove dirt, dust, and debris accumulated on light fixtures.
- Gently clean lenses or covers using mild soap and water.
- Avoid abrasive materials that may scratch surfaces.
-
Inspecting Connections:
- Periodically inspect electrical connections for signs of wear or damage.
- Tighten loose connections securely but avoid overtightening.
- Replace any corroded or damaged connectors promptly.
-
Replacing Faulty Bulbs Promptly:
- Keep spare bulbs on hand to replace any burnt-out or malfunctioning ones immediately.
- Ensure compatibility by checking bulb specifications before purchasing replacements.
-
Protect Against Harsh Weather Conditions:
- Consider weather-resistant fixtures designed specifically for outdoor use.
- Use protective coverings for vulnerable areas or during extreme weather events.
